目的建立用2,4-二硝基苯肼衍生高效液相色谱法(HPLC)测定仿瓷餐具中甲醛的方法。方法样品中甲醛浸提后,用2,4-二硝基苯肼衍生转化为甲醛-2,4-二硝基苯腙,在phenomenex Gemini-C18柱上,以甲醇-水(7+3)为流动相进行分离,HPLC-UV检测器在355 nm测定,外标法定量。结果该方法取1.0 ml浸泡液测定,对应的最低检出量为0.1 mg/dm2,回收率92%~102%。测定精密度RSD在2.6%~6.3%。结论该方法操作简单,检测灵敏度高,干扰少,结果准确,适用于仿瓷餐具甲醛的测定。
Objective To establish a method for the determination of formaldehyde in porcelain tableware by HPLC with 2,4-dinitrophenylhydrazine. Methods The samples were extracted with formaldehyde and converted into formaldehyde-2,4-dinitrophenylhydrazone by 2,4-dinitrophenylhydrazine. The crude product was separated on a phenomenex Gemini-C18 column with methanol-water (7 + 3) To separate the mobile phase, the HPLC-UV detector was determined at 355 nm and was quantified by external standard method. Results The method was measured with 1.0 ml of soaking solution, with the lowest detection limit of 0.1 mg / dm2 and the recovery of 92% -102%. Determination of precision RSD 2.6% ~ 6.3%. Conclusion The method is simple, sensitive, less interference and accurate. It is suitable for the determination of formaldehyde in porcelain tableware.
